As a window and door fitter, you will be responsible for fitting windows and doors on our buildings, ensuring they are installed to the highest standards and meet the design requirements and also to the tight timescales to meet deadlines, your role may include some other work helping out other departments when needed. You will play an important role in the success of our construction projects by using your technical skills and attention to detail to ensure the windows and doors are secure, functional, and visually appealing.
